A surplus of 1.8 billion HK dollars (230.87 million U.S. dollars) was recorded in the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region government's financial results for the first month of the current financial year, Hong Kong Financial Services and the Treasury Bureau said on Friday.
The figure brings the HKSAR government's fiscal reserves to 494. 8 billion HK dollars (63.46 billion U.S. dollars).
April saw 20.4 billion HK dollars (2.62 billion U.S. dollars) in spending and 22.2 billion HK dollars (2.85 billion U.S. dollars) in revenue, resulting in a surplus of 1.8 billion HK dollars (230. 87 million U.S. dollars). The surplus was mainly dueto collection of salaries tax, profits tax and stamp duties, the bureau said.
The total government debts stood at 20.08 billion HK dollars (2.58 billion U.S. dollars).
